Introduction

Whey protein concentrate is a staple in the world of fitness supplements, renowned for its high protein content and quick absorption. This supplement is particularly favored by those looking to enhance their workout performance and recovery. With approximately 70-80% protein content, whey protein concentrate not only aids in muscle growth but also supports weight management by promoting satiety.

Incorporating whey protein concentrate into your daily routine can significantly boost your protein intake. Whether you blend it into smoothies, mix it with oatmeal, or bake it into protein bars, the versatility of whey protein makes it easy to enjoy. Furthermore, it contains essential amino acids, particularly leucine, which plays a crucial role in muscle protein synthesis.

As you consider adding whey protein concentrate to your fitness regimen, it's important to choose high-quality products that are free from unnecessary additives. Look for brands that provide third-party testing to ensure purity and effectiveness. FAQs

Whey protein concentrate is a dietary supplement made from the liquid byproduct of cheese production, containing a high level of protein and essential amino acids.

You can mix whey protein concentrate with water or milk, blend it into smoothies, or add it to baked goods for a protein boost.

While whey protein concentrate is safe for most people, those with lactose intolerance or dairy allergies should consult a healthcare professional before use.

Whey protein concentrate helps in muscle building, aids recovery after workouts, supports weight management, and provides essential nutrients.

Yes, many people incorporate whey protein concentrate into their daily diet to meet their protein needs, especially if they are active.
